‘No Chance’ – Celtic ‘Source’ Shoots Down Defender Transfer Claim

Celtic really need to get a move on with regards to bringing in defensive reinforcements.

There are just over two weeks left of this current transfer window and after a promising start with a flurry of signings while in Dubai, things have seemed to stall.

It’s vital Celtic get a right back in before the window closes but with all the rumours flying around you can forget about one of those options.

Micah Richards name was bandied about after very soft media reports linked the Aston Villa reject with a move to the Scottish Champions. However, Michael Gannon at RecordSport was on the case, and while Celtic sources don’t tend to pipe up when there’s a deal close for someone, they do usually quash any outlandish rumours.

‘Sources’ have said there is ‘no chance’ of the English defender ending up at Celtic Park before the window closes which would abruptly put that rumour to bed.
